How long is the flight from Frankfurt to Rajasthan?

~7.5–8.5 hrs (non-stop) to Delhi. The circuit begins at Delhi (DEL); A major hub with strong non-stop frequency into Delhi (DEL).

Do I need a visa to travel from Germany to India?

India offers an e-Visa to travellers of many nationalities; requirements vary by passport. Our concierge advises on the current process for Germany passport holders as part of planning.

How many days should I plan from Frankfurt?

Factor the ~7.5–8.5 hrs (non-stop) to Delhi crossing into the trip length. For Rajasthan specifically, the recommended length is 7–10 days for the core Jaipur–Udaipur–Jodhpur arc; longer to include Jaisalmer or Ranthambore.
